From 2880f2b4c1fd69e66ffb157965dc2d744ead4bfc Mon Sep 17 00:00:00 2001 From: Redume Date: Sun, 11 Aug 2024 19:46:07 +0300 Subject: [PATCH] =?UTF-8?q?=D0=A2=D0=B5=D0=BF=D0=B5=D1=80=D1=8C=20=D0=BC?= =?UTF-8?q?=D0=BE=D0=B6=D0=BD=D0=BE=20=D0=B2=D1=8B=D1=81=D1=82=D0=B0=D0=B2?= =?UTF-8?q?=D0=B8=D1=82=D1=8C=20=D1=83=D1=80=D0=BE=D0=B2=D0=B5=D0=BD=D1=8C?= =?UTF-8?q?=20=D0=B2=D0=B2=D0=B5=D0=B4=D0=B5=D0=BD=D0=B8=D0=B5=20=D0=BB?= =?UTF-8?q?=D0=BE=D0=B3=D0=B0?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- config_sample.yaml | 4 +++- logger/main.js | 2 +- server/main.js | 2 +- 3 files changed, 5 insertions(+), 3 deletions(-) diff --git a/config_sample.yaml b/config_sample.yaml index 6007db4..6aeffe1 100644 --- a/config_sample.yaml +++ b/config_sample.yaml @@ -12,7 +12,9 @@ server: private_key: '/CertSSL/private.key' # The path to the private SSL key file (String) cert: '/CertSSL/fullchain.pem' # The path to the SSL certificate (String) ssl: true # Enable or disable SSL support [Boolean] - debug: true # Enable or disable log [Boolean] + log: + print: true # Enable or disable logging [Boolean] + level: 'info' # Log level (Fatal/Error/Warn/Log/Debug) [String] currency: chart: save_chart: false # Enable or disable saving graphs to an image (Boolean) diff --git a/logger/main.js b/logger/main.js index f2c2219..ce6d1b2 100644 --- a/logger/main.js +++ b/logger/main.js @@ -3,7 +3,7 @@ const pretty = require('pino-pretty'); const config = require('../config/main.js')(); const logger = pino({ - level: config['server']['debug'] ? 'debug' : 'info', + level: config['server']['log']['level'] ? config['server']['log']['level'] : null, }, pretty()); module.exports = logger; \ No newline at end of file diff --git a/server/main.js b/server/main.js index 43a0e99..e1d5a85 100644 --- a/server/main.js +++ b/server/main.js @@ -3,7 +3,7 @@ const config = require('../config/main.js')(); const fs = require('fs'); const fastify = require('fastify')({ - logger: config['server']['debug'] ? logger : false, + logger: config['server']['log']['print'] ? logger : false, ...config['server']['ssl'] ? { https: { key: fs.readFileSync(config['server']['private_key'], 'utf8'),